DESCRIPTION:First Congregational Church\, United Church of Christ\, Rochester is hosting a showing of the movie Jesus Revolution\, free of charge and open to the public on Friday\, November 10\, 2023 at 7:30 p.m. The church is located at 1315 N. Pine Street\, Rochester.\n\nRated PG\, the movie tells "the story of one young hippie's quest in the 1970s for belonging and liberation that leads not only to peace\, love\, and rock and roll\, but that sets into motion a new counterculture crusade   a Jesus Movement   changing the course of history. Inspired by a true movement\, Jesus Revolution tells the story of a young Greg Laurie (Joel Courtney) being raised by his struggling mother\, Charlene (Kimberly Williams-Paisley) in the 1970s. Laurie and a sea of young people descend on sunny Southern California to redefine truth through all means of liberation. Inadvertently\, Laurie meets Lonnie Frisbee (Jonathan Roumie)\, a charismatic hippie-street-preacher\, and Pastor Chuck Smith (Kelsey Grammer) who have thrown open the doors of Smith's languishing church to a stream of wandering youth. Rock and roll\, newfound love\, and a twist of faith lead to a 'Jesus Revolution' that turns one counterculture movement into a revival that changes the world\," according to Rotten Tomatoes.\n\n"Now is a good time to look back and revisit this moment in history\," commented Pastor Scott Cunningham. "Everyone is welcome to stay after the movie for a discussion\," he added.
